The Theory and Design of Organization course at Wuhan University (often taught within the Economics and Management School or Business/Management programs) explores the fundamental principles that explain how organizations are structured, how they function, and how they adapt to internal and external challenges. It combines organizational theory, which examines the key concepts and models that describe why organizations exist and behave the way they do, with organizational design, the process of shaping or reshaping an organization’s structure to align with strategy, environment, culture, and goals. Students study classical and contemporary theories of organization, the relationship between strategy and structural choices, organizational processes such as authority, decision-making, and communication, and practical approaches for designing effective organizational systems. Through lectures, case studies, and analytical frameworks, the course equips learners with the ability to critically assess different organizational structures, understand factors that affect effectiveness, and propose design solutions to improve performance, innovation, and adaptability in both domestic and global business contexts.
